Delhi University will be conducting Delhi University Entrance Test (DUET) for the admission of candidates to undergraduate and postgraduate degree programmes. Candidates will be offered admissions through either Delhi University Entrance Test (DUET) or merit list of qualifying examination or specified provisions for which the candidates must register online to take part in this admission process. The admission authority of Delhi University will commence online application of DUET 2019 tentatively from May 24, 2019. The authorities will release the admit card of DUET 2019 in an online mode by third week of June. DUET 2019 entrance examination will be conducted tentatively in third week of June in the offline mode. DUET 2019 result will likely be declared by the first week of July. Candidates who will qualify from the written examination will be invited to attend the interview or group discussion. The merit list will then be prepared based on which candidates will be offered admission to respective degree (UG & PG) programmes.
